Matangi String Quartet 2006, June 30 – July 6

The Matangi String Quartet performs concerts and masterclasses in Bangkok, Kuala Lumpur and Singapore.
The En Accord String Quartet 2006, January 24 – 26

The En Accord String Quartet, one of the most promising string quartets from the Netherlands, performs at the "Dutch Week" in Amman, Jordan. They also conduct a masterclass at the National Conservatory.
Worms & Pameijer 2005, November 25 – December 3

Marcel Worms (piano) and Eleonore Pameijer (flute), perform concerts in various cities in India and Sri Lanka. On the program various pieces from their "six continents project".
Ronald Brautigam 2005, March 30

The famous pianist, Ronald Brautigam performed a concert in Singapore as part of a more extensive tour in Southeast Asia. After the concert, the listeners had plenty of opportunity to interact with Mr. Brautigam.
Collectif 2005, February 18 – 20

The debut-performance of the Dutch gipsy-jazz group "Collectif" in India, played two concerts in Bangalore. Collectif also performed an interactive session in which not only violin or guitar students, but all others interested were made acquainted with the fabulous world of "Hot club the France" music, made famous by people like S. Grapelly and D. Reinhardt.
Tjeerd 2004, October 3 – 13

Tjeerd Top, the 25-year-old, newly-appointed 1st assistant Concertmaster of the Royal Concertgebouw Orchestra in Amsterdam, has performed concerts in Mumbai, Bangalore and Colombo. He was accompanied by his regular pianist Mariken Zandvliet who is a teacher at the Conservatories of Amsterdam and Utrecht.

Ratnayake 2004, February

Lanco Concerts supported the 8th East West Festival in Bangalore by bringing over the Amsterdam Chamber Orchestra and sponsoring one of the most distinguished soloists of this festival, the Sitar Virtuoso, Mr. Pradeep Ratnayake. Mr. Ratnayake played as a soloist with the ACO, performing the Sitar Concerto of Mr. Lalanath de Silva (Colombo, Sri Lanka).
Janine Jansen 2003, October

The Concertgebouw Chamber Orchestra, conducted by Marco Boni, with Janine Jansen as soloist performed five concerts in Mumbai and Delhi.
